How Types Of Lawn Grass Southern California Actually Works

Types Of Lawn Grass Southern California encompass grasses specifically selected or adapted to thrive under regional conditions: intense sunlight, low moisture, and variable temperatures. California Monopoly These grasses include well-established varieties such as Bermudagrass, Zoysiagrass, and Bahia grass—each offering unique benefits in heat tolerance, wear resistance, and water efficiency.

Unlike traditional lawns requiring heavy irrigation, these types feature deep root systems and natural drought adaptation, allowing them to remain resilient during dry spells. Maintenance focuses on timing, mowing practices, and soil conditions suited to local climates, often reducing the need for chemical treatments and frequent watering. This functional efficiency makes them ideal for both residential lawns and commercial landscapes across urban and suburban Southern California.

Common Questions People Have About Types Of Lawn Grass Southern California

Q: Which grass type is best for Southern California’s climate? California Monopoly Bermudagrass and Zoysiagrass top performance in full sun and high temperatures, offering dense coverage with moderate water needs when properly established.

Q: Do these grasses require a lot of water? While established lawns need less frequent irrigation, newly planted grass and ongoing care during extreme heat demand consistent moisture for 3–4 months or during extended dry periods.

Q: How do I maintain a lawn with these grass types? Mowing at recommended heights, periodic fertilization, and soil testing support health—avoid overwatering, which can encourage shallow rooting.

Q: Are these grasses suitable for foot traffic? Yes. Bermudagrass and Zoysiagrass are especially praised for durability under foot, pet, and outdoor activity, making them popular for family lawns and recreational spaces.

Opportunities and Considerations

Pros: - Significant water savings compared to non-adapted grasses - High resistance to heat and disease - Low chemical input maintenance - Visible green appeal throughout warm months

Cons: - Higher upfront cost and installation complexity - Limited shade tolerance (not suitable under trees) - Seasonal dormancy in extreme heat or cold periods

Understanding these factors helps set realistic expectations and ensures informed investment in lawn health and sustainability.
